Leslie Bricusse is a highly acclaimed British composer and lyricist whose remarkable career has spanned over six decades. Born on January 29, 1931, in London, Bricusse has become known for his unparalleled contributions to the world of musical theater, film, and popular music. His immense talent and signature style have earned him numerous awards and accolades, making him a true icon in the entertainment industry.

Bricusse first rose to prominence in the 1960s, collaborating with renowned composer Anthony Newley on a series of successful musicals and film scores. Together, they created some of the most beloved songs in the history of musical theater, including "Pure Imagination" from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ory and "Feeling Good" from The Roar of the Greasepaint – The Smell of the Crowd. Their unique brand of musical storytelling and catchy melodies captivated audiences and solidified Bricusse's reputation as a master of his craft.

In addition to his work with Newley, Bricusse has also collaborated with other legendary composers and artists, such as John Williams, Andrew Lloyd Webber, and Henry Mancini, further showcasing the breadth of his talent and versatility. His impressive body of work includes scores for iconic films like Doctor Dolittle, Goodbye, Mr. Chips, and Victor/Victoria, as well as hit musicals like Stop the World – I Want to Get Off, Scrooge, and Jekyll & Hyde. Bricusse's ability to craft memorable melodies and poignant lyrics has made him a sought-after collaborator in the entertainment industry, with his songs being performed by some of the most celebrated performers in the world.

Throughout his career, Bricusse has been honored with numerous awards and accolades for his contributions to the arts. He has received multiple Academy Award nominations for Best Original Song, as well as a Grammy Award for Song of the Year. In addition, he has been recognized with the Ivor Novello Award for Outstanding Contribution to British Music, further cementing his status as a musical luminary. What musicals did Leslie Bricusse write?

He was a five-time Tony nominee for “Stop the World” (musical, book, score), “Roar of the Greasepaint” (score) and “Jekyll & Hyde” (book). For film, he wrote the Oscar-nominated musical “Goodbye, Mr. Chips,” with Peter O'Toole, in 1969; and, with Mancini, the songs for “Santa Claus” in 1985.


How old was Leslie Bricusse when he died?

Bricusse died in his sleep in Saint-Paul-de-Vence, France, on 19 October 2021, at the age of 90.


Who sang the original Pure Imagination?

"Pure Imagination" is a song from the 1971 film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ory. It was written by British composers Leslie Bricusse and Anthony Newley specifically for the movie. It was sung by Gene Wilder who played the character of Willy Wonka.


Who wrote talk to the animals?

"Talk to the Animals" is a song written by British composer Leslie Bricusse.
